It may be necessary to apply different listening strategies in different listening contexts. Listening is an
important skill in professional contexts, but most people are not explicitly taught it. Listening environments
should promote and reward competent listening behaviours within an organization. Relational contexts call
for listening to initiate relationships, as it is necessary for self-disclosure, and to maintain them, as listening
provides a psychological reward. Not being listened to can cause people to feel isolated or lonely, which
can negatively impact their lives (Anon, 2020). Listening preferences and behaviors can be influenced by
high-context and low-context communication styles, monochronistic or polychronic orientations toward
time, individualistic or collectivistic values, and monochronic or polychronic cultural values. There has been
conflicting research regarding men's and women's listening preferences. Although there are some
differences in listening between men and women, many of these are a result of societal expectations
regarding how men and women should listen rather than biological differences.
